编程前台后端什么意思

fiy 其他 5

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程中的前台和后端是指软件开发中的两个不同层次和功能的部分。

    前台(Frontend)指的是用户直接与之交互的界面部分,也就是用户所看到和操作的界面。前台主要负责展示数据、接收用户的输入和操作,并将其传递给后端进行处理。前台的开发主要使用HTML、CSS和JavaScript等技术来实现,常见的前台开发框架有React、Vue、Angular等。

    后端(Backend)指的是服务器端的逻辑和功能部分,负责处理前台发送过来的请求,执行相应的操作,并将结果返回给前台。后端主要负责数据的存储、处理和逻辑的处理。后端的开发使用各种编程语言和框架来实现,常见的后端开发语言有Java、Python、PHP等,常见的后端开发框架有Spring、Django、Laravel等。

    前台和后端之间通过网络进行通信,前台发送请求给后端,后端处理请求并返回相应的结果给前台。前台和后端协同工作,共同完成一个完整的软件系统。

    总而言之,前台和后端是软件开发中的两个不可或缺的部分,前台负责用户界面的展示和交互,后端负责处理数据和逻辑,二者通过网络通信协同工作,共同构建一个完整的应用程序。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程前端和后端是指在软件开发中,对应于前台和后台两个不同的工作领域。

    1. 前端编程:前端开发是指负责构建用户直接与之交互的界面部分。前端开发员通常使用HTML、CSS和JavaScript等技术,开发网页、移动应用等前台界面。他们负责将设计师提供的视觉设计转化为具体的网页或应用界面,并实现用户与界面的交互功能。

    2. 后端编程:后端开发是指负责构建应用程序的核心功能和逻辑的部分。后端开发员通常使用各种编程语言(如Java、Python、PHP等)和数据库技术,开发服务器端的应用程序。他们负责处理用户请求、数据存储、业务逻辑等任务,并与前端进行数据交互。

    3. 前端与后端的交互:前端和后端通过网络进行通信,实现数据的传输和交互。前端将用户的操作请求发送到后端服务器,后端根据请求进行相应的处理,并返回结果给前端。这样前后端就可以实现用户与应用程序之间的交互。

    4. 前后端的协作:前端和后端开发员通常在一个项目中密切合作,共同完成一个完整的应用程序。设计师提供的界面设计会被前端开发员转化为实际的网页或应用界面。后端开发员根据前端的需求,构建相应的服务器端逻辑,并提供接口供前端调用。

    5. 前后端技术栈:前端和后端开发员需要掌握不同的技术栈。前端开发员需要熟悉HTML、CSS、JavaScript等前端技术,以及各种前端框架和工具。后端开发员需要熟悉相应的编程语言和框架,以及数据库等后端技术。两者需要对网络通信和安全等方面有一定的了解。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程中的“前台”和“后端”是指软件开发中的两个不同的方面。

    前台(Frontend)指的是用户直接与之交互的部分,也被称为客户端。前台开发主要涉及用户界面设计和用户体验,负责将后端提供的数据进行展示和交互。前台开发常用的技术包括HTML、CSS和JavaScript等。

    后端(Backend)指的是运行在服务器端的软件,也被称为服务端。后端开发主要负责处理前台发送的请求,进行数据处理和逻辑处理,并将结果返回给前台。后端开发常用的技术包括服务器端的编程语言,如Java、Python、PHP等,以及数据库的操作。

    前台和后端的协作流程一般如下:

    1. 前台开发人员根据需求设计用户界面,并使用HTML和CSS进行页面布局和样式设计。
    2. 前台开发人员使用JavaScript编写交互逻辑,实现用户与页面的交互功能,如表单验证、按钮点击事件等。
    3. 前台开发人员通过Ajax等技术将用户的请求发送给后端。
    4. 后端开发人员接收到前台发送的请求,根据请求的内容进行数据处理和逻辑处理。
    5. 后端开发人员可能需要与数据库进行交互,进行数据的读取、写入和修改等操作。
    6. 后端开发人员将处理结果封装成响应,并发送给前台。
    7. 前台开发人员接收到后端的响应,根据响应的内容进行页面的更新和展示。

    通过前台和后端的协作,用户可以在前台界面上进行各种操作,如登录、注册、提交表单等,后端则负责处理这些操作并返回相应的结果。这样,前台和后端的协作实现了用户与服务器之间的交互。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部